Kinnikinnickโs Angel Food Cake Mix is a gluten-free, allergen-friendly baking essential that creates light, airy cakes with a perfect texture. Free from dairy, nuts, peanuts, soy, and wheat, this 3-pack of 15.9 oz boxes is ideal for those with dietary restrictions seeking indulgent, worry-free desserts. Trusted since 1991, Kinnikinnick combines family expertise with inclusive baking innovation.

Makes a perfect angel food cake
I was so afraid of making this cake because I've never made an angel food cake before. But now I need it gluten free and got the cake mix and an angel food cake pan (you really need one of these, people). And yes, angel food cakes take 10 to 12 egg whites, gluten free perhaps more because gf baking requires a bit more liquid. Anyhow. I make the cake and it lofted high and turned out beautifully and had that perfect cottony texture. Wasn't gritty wasn't too sweet could not have been any more perfect. I made a trifle with it and it held up just fine to the wet ingredients tho it was also wonderful on its own. I definitely plan to make it again (I bought two boxes in case I flubbed the first one) and serve it the traditional angel food cake way with strawberries and whipped cream. Perhaps I'll stock up and make some more trifle in the future.
